Transaction 2834dfe81333bcf858ba35cafff376bfd7650500c1c0260d4eb9670c8e3d2a30
1 Input
1 Output
-
2834dfe81333bcf858ba35cafff376bfd7650500c1c0260d4eb9670c8e3d2a30:0
- value
- 19312433
- script pubkey
- OP_0 OP_PUSHBYTES_32 3e858b87d771459b6046fb22b5ade6f4d7e28e3c69a08b7e922e579d321f650e
- address
- bc1q86zchp7hw9zekczxlv3ttt0x7nt79r3udxsgkl5j9ete6vslv58q2dyqg3